🌧️ Spring in New York: What Could Change for Your Home

Spring weather in New York may include heavy rainfall, melting snow, and fluctuating temperatures. These conditions may increase the risk of:

  • Water damage from clogged gutters or sump pump issues

  • Roof leaks from winter wear and tear

  • Basement flooding due to ground saturation

  • Tree damage from spring storms and wind

A review of your homeowners insurance policy may help you better understand what is covered and where additional protection might be helpful.


🏡 Home Insurance: Spring Coverage Considerations

This season may be a good time to:

1. Review your current policy
Coverage limits and deductibles may need adjustment based on home value changes or recent upgrades.

2. Document home improvements
Renovations or additions may impact your coverage needs.

3. Consider additional protection
Some risks, like flooding, may require separate policies depending on your location in New York.

4. Check liability coverage
With more outdoor activity in spring, liability risks may increase.


🌱 Life Insurance: A Fresh Start for Financial Protection

Spring is also a natural time to reflect on your family’s future.

Life insurance may help provide financial support to your loved ones in the event of the unexpected. If you’ve experienced any major life changes, such as marriage, a new home, or growing your family, your current coverage may no longer reflect your needs.

You may want to consider:

  • Whether your current coverage amount is still appropriate

  • If your beneficiaries are up to date

  • How your policy fits into your long-term financial goals
